Seward named 'Cop of the Year'

Posted

Police Officer Tim Seward has been selected by a committee of his peers as the Rockville Centre Police Officer of the Year for 2009.

Officer Seward recently received his award at the annual Elks "Cop of the Year Dinner" at the Lynbrook Elks Lodge. The ceremonial event recognizes police officers from various South Shore commands for outstanding achievement.

"Tim is one of the best street cops I have observed in my career," said Rockville Centre Police Commissioner Charles Gennario. "He possesses outstanding intuition and is an exceptional investigator, a tireless worker and a true asset to the department."

Officer Seward is a five-year veteran of the village department. Prior to joining Rockville Centre force, he was a detective in the New York City Police Department.
